My Repliglass enlarged A9X scoop is just shy of 5" tall, so it would be close to what you're looking for. Shown in my build thread here:

http://www.gmh-toran...atch/?p=1042021

I cut mine down in length (and moved it back) as much as I could while still clearing my front intake trumpets. With a single carburetor, you could probably cut it a little shorter/further back again if you wanted, as you don't have the front trumpets sticking through the bonnet that you need to worry about.

 

Repliglass said in an e-mail to me when I was doing my research:
"These are the only ones I could find the end picture is showing the 3 different sizes we have. The middle one being the standard scoop, sizes of the scoops are

SL/R SCOOP 900MM LONG X 580MM WIDE X 90MM HIGH IN THE CENTRE

OVERSIZED SCOOP 1100MM LONG X 630MM WIDE X 120MM HIGH"

I personally think the are visually very dominating, but if you've got the "weight" of wide wheels and flares, spoilers etc. then it helps to balance that out.

If you leave them the standard length (they are much longer than a factory A9X scoop as you can see in the photo above), I think they look quite bad, haha.
